Starting Out Your Miami Real Estate Investment
Miami real estate offers tons of commercial and residential properties you can use as business niche if you want to invest in the city. But if you have no idea on how to begin, then here are some tips on how to get started on this major project. Tip # 1: Check Out The Market First Before you start your investment in Miami real estate, you might want to check the market first if it can be a lucrative business or not. Residential and commercial properties in the city are always in abundance, but you might want to check their prices first if they are within the range of your finances. In most cases, the real estate market has never been constant. The prices of various properties fluctuate from time to time, so you might want to acquire them when the median prices are at its lowest, and sell them out when the prices are high. Tip # 2: Determine Your Market Once you have an idea on how to keep a close eye on the real estate market in Miami, you now need to determine what property would fit perfectly with your goals. Residential properties in Miami have always been on the number one spot on the list of many homebuyers in and out of the city. The various opportunities in the area, both business and leisure, are reason enough to move in with the rest of the family. For this scenario, condominiums are the most favorable investment with the current demand of the market for a luxury home. Commercial properties are also a sound investment considering the bustling economy in Miami, Florida. From retail stores to office spaces, budding businesses in the city needs their own space that will serve as the foundation of their venture. Whether you're planning to invest in residential or commercial properties, you might want to check the demand first to ensure that you won't be wasting your money over nothing. Tip # 3: Consult An Expert Realtor If it's your first time investing in Miami for a real estate property, then it is advisable to consult a realtor to help you out. These professionals are very much acquainted with the real estate market in the city, and they can provide you certain information on what are the hottest buys in the real estate business. Before you start investing, consult with a realtor on the various figures on the real estate market in Miami, Florida. Inquire about possible opportunities in buying and selling properties, as well as the current status of the economy that will affect the success of your business investment.
